Actually, if you'd like switched power near the front end of the bike it's perfectly OK to tap the wires that feed the optional 12V plug accessory socket in the top left of the front trunk compartment.

Small fuse if that's all you're feeding. 3 amp should be plenty, smaller is even better, but they can be harder to find. Your Zumo instructions may specify a fuse size.Make sure you put a fuse in the + side.
